《PHP應(yīng)用:詳解Yii2.0 rules驗(yàn)證規(guī)則集合》要點(diǎn):
本文介紹了PHP應(yīng)用:詳解Yii2.0 rules驗(yàn)證規(guī)則集合,希望對(duì)您有用。如果有疑問(wèn),可以聯(lián)系我們。
相關(guān)主題:YII框架
我最近也在學(xué)習(xí)Yii2的路上,那么今天也算個(gè)學(xué)習(xí)筆記吧!
PHP實(shí)戰(zhàn)
required : 必須值驗(yàn)證屬性PHP實(shí)戰(zhàn)
email : 郵箱驗(yàn)證PHP實(shí)戰(zhàn)
match : 正則驗(yàn)證PHP實(shí)戰(zhàn)
[['字段名'],match,'pattern'=>'正則表達(dá)式','message'=>'提示信息']; [['字段名'],match,'not'=>ture,'pattern'=>'正則表達(dá)式','message'=>'提示信息']; /*正則取反*/ #說(shuō)明:CRegularExpressionValidator 的別名, 確保了特性匹配一個(gè)正則表達(dá)式.
url : 網(wǎng)址PHP實(shí)戰(zhàn)
captcha : 驗(yàn)證碼PHP實(shí)戰(zhàn)
safe : 安全PHP實(shí)戰(zhàn)
['description', 'safe'];
compare : 比較PHP實(shí)戰(zhàn)
default : 默認(rèn)值PHP實(shí)戰(zhàn)
exist : 存在PHP實(shí)戰(zhàn)
file : 文件PHP實(shí)戰(zhàn)
filter : 濾鏡PHP實(shí)戰(zhàn)
in : 范圍PHP實(shí)戰(zhàn)
unique : 唯一性PHP實(shí)戰(zhàn)
integer : 整數(shù)PHP實(shí)戰(zhàn)
['age', 'integer'];
number : 數(shù)字PHP實(shí)戰(zhàn)
['salary', 'number'];
double : 雙精度浮點(diǎn)型PHP實(shí)戰(zhàn)
['salary', 'double'];
date : 日期PHP實(shí)戰(zhàn)
[['from', 'to'], 'date'];
string : 字符串PHP實(shí)戰(zhàn)
['username', 'string', 'length' => [4, 24]];
boolean : 是否為一個(gè)布爾值PHP實(shí)戰(zhàn)
image :是否為有效的圖片文件PHP實(shí)戰(zhàn)
如有錯(cuò)誤,請(qǐng)指出,自己也做個(gè)小筆記,謝謝大家.也希望大家多多支持維易PHP.PHP實(shí)戰(zhàn)
轉(zhuǎn)載請(qǐng)注明本頁(yè)網(wǎng)址:
http://www.snjht.com/jiaocheng/1345.html